Then I started to think what if a human from this time who is used to all the comforts of the world and the civilization we've come to know is suddenly swapped with another human from maybe the early stages of mankind when we were still cave dwellers. Who would survive better?

A modern human would have an advantage because they can easily understand what must've happened, but adapting to the situation would be very tough. First is even basic stuff like healthcare, because his body is most likely not ready for all the germs and bacteria that the cave human must've been able to live with. Next is the complete cut off from electronics, almost every human today depends on one form of electronics or the other. Then comes food, imagine not being able to order your favorite pizza or eat chocolate (I'm not sure I can survive without bread and beans).

For the cave dweller, it must look like the world had gone crazy. First is communication, I'm not even sure humans had developed language back then. Then the amount of civilization would just be too much. A human being from say 100 years ago would be surprised at the tech available but could easily adapt because he already understands how technology works. But the cave dweller probably hasn't even seen fire in his entire life and you want to introduce him to a smartphone, thinking about it already sounds impossible to me.

There are probably numerous factors that would work to the advantage of disadvantage of both human. Who do you think has the better chance of adapting and surviving?
